To encourage eatery outlets to reduce food waste at source together with customers through offering portioned meals and adopting food waste reduction measures, the Environmental Protection Department has launched the “Food Wise Eateries” Scheme. Participants will be awarded with a Food Wise Eateries (FWE) accreditation status if they comply with the assessment criteria and will be granted with the FWE Logo and Stickers for displaying in the premises and their promotion for public identification. Applications are accepted all year round and are FREE of charge.

Taste & Value:
It said on the menu that lunch sets were availabe from mon- fri, but when my sister and I ordered, we were informed that because it was a public holiday, they weren't available even though it was monday. I was really bummed out, as the lunch sets were much greater deals. If I had known this, I would have visited another day.   
 It was my sister who suggested to try it anyways.

The fish & chips were wrapped in paper like how it is when you buy coldcuts.
Before ordering, we asked how big the fish was, and we were told it was about 100g.

Blue Cod with 1 scoop of Chips + Oysters (3) ($75 + $20+ $40) The first thing I tried was the oyster. The batter was quite chewy, and the oysters were big, juicy and tasted like the sea.

The cod was a little tough, but it was good. The chips were fresh, but could have been more crispy. You get to choose a salt, and we chose garlic salt, which was quite nice. Although it added flavour to the food, it made everything even more dry. It would have been nice if sauce was given on the side instead of having to purchase it for an extra $5 -$10. What I liked best was the batter of the seafood, as it was light and not greasy. I would describe it to be similar to a tempura batter.

Final Verdict:
Batter is important for fish and chips, and this was one that I liked. I would go again for the lunch sets in the future.
